The Peakhour Page Weight tool has been developed to show opportunities for reducing page weight on a given page. For now, the tool just analyses images to make sure each image is properly sized, uses the best format, and has the best compression level. Images are usually the heaviest part of a page, so optimising them can mean significant improvements in load times. Leading to more engaged, and higher converting customers.
Q. What does SSIM mean?SSIM = structural similarity index measure
SSIM is a method of measuring the perceived similarity between two images. If SSIM = 100% then two images would look exactly the same when viewed side by side. For the purposes of our report we've chosen a SSIM value of 95% when testing the quality level for compressions. This ensures we get the smallest possible file without losing much quality when viewed side by side. If you are using Peakhour then this value can be tweaked.
